How to prepare for a job interview at Aspire People
β¨Know Your Stuff
Make sure youβre well-versed in the curriculum and teaching methods relevant to the role. Brush up on your QTS knowledge and be ready to discuss how youβve applied it in your previous teaching experiences.
β¨Showcase Your Passion
During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through. Share specific examples of how you've inspired students or created engaging lessons that cater to different learning styles.
β¨Behaviour Management Strategies
Be prepared to discuss your approach to behaviour management. Have a few real-life scenarios ready where you successfully handled challenging situations, demonstrating your skills and adaptability.
β¨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, donβt forget to ask questions! Inquire about the schoolβs culture, support for teachers, and opportunities for professional development. This shows your genuine interest in being part of their community.
